Настройка высоты прокрутки DIV с помощью javascript и css

#javascript #html #css

#javascript #HTML #css

Вопрос:

У меня есть этот div, который появляется при запуске действия. Когда я прокручиваю страницу вниз, она по-прежнему остается в верхней части страницы. Я хочу установить высоту прокрутки таким образом, чтобы она перемещалась относительно положения прокрутки страницы. Простое определение position : relative не работает. Как я могу использовать javascript для этого? Справка.

     <form name="" action="" method="POST">
     <div id='divSearchAndReplace'>
     <table id='divSearchAndReplace_Header' width='100%'>               
     <tr>
        <td>                        
            <table>
            <tr>
                <td align='left'></td>
            </tr>
            </table>                    
        </td>                   
    </tr>
    </table>

    <table width='100%' border='0' cellspacing="4" cellpadding="2">             
    <tr><td colspan='2' nowrap height='10px'></td></tr>
    <tr valign="top">

    </tr>
    <tr><td colspan='2' align='right' style='padding-right:12px;'><input class='form_button' type='submit' name='btnSubmit' value='Replace' onclick='return checkSearchAndReplace();'/></td></tr>    
    </table>
</div>
</form>
  

это css

 #divSearchAndReplace { width:450px; height:240px; border:1px solid #336699; background-color:#ffffff; position:absolute; left:200px; top:75px; display:none; }
#divSearchAndReplace table { width:450px; border:0px; align:center; }
  

Ответ №1:

Может быть, вы ищете position: fixed в CSS?

Комментарии:

1. Это сделало это. Интересно, что я думал о сложных решениях. Спасибо, чувак. 1